Fit a simple least-squares linear regression model and calculate slope, intercept, R squared, and predictions
Call this tool from your code in three languages.
curl -X POST 'https://api.elysiatools.com/en/api/tools/linear-regression-calculator' \
-H 'Content-Type: application/json' \
-d '{"pairedData":"1, 2\n2, 4\n3, 5\n4, 4\n5, 5","xValues":"","yValues":"","predictionX":"6","decimalPlaces":4}'Send a POST request with your inputs as JSON. File parameters require a separate upload first.
POST https://api.elysiatools.com/en/api/tools/linear-regression-calculator| Name | Type | Required |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| pairedData | textarea | No | — |
| xValues | text | No | — |
| yValues | text | No | — |
| predictionX | text | No | — |
| decimalPlaces | number | No | — |
